I'm getting my cdl next year, is it better to have experience driving a bigger vehicle before i get my cdl? I'm getting my class a cdl?

I'm going to get a job driving a ford f450 dump truck hauling an excavator on a 20ft equipment trailer… I believe that if i have experience driving a bigger vehicle w/ or w/o a trailer will help, is this true

Not necessarily. An F-450 isn't any bigger than a standard "full sized" pickup truck, so driving a bigger truck wouldn't really help. But you ARE going to need some experience in driving a truck and towing a trailer before you can pass your road test. The CDL-A road test requires you to back up and park with a trailer attached, and THAT requires practice.
